Abstract

Compiled PTX diagram and trans-sects for sub-cratonic mantle lithosphere (SCLM) >of 150 kimberlitic pipes including those from Yakutia. Major regularities were determined for by the comparison of the PTX diagram for the subcratonic lithospheric mantle (SCLM) according to mantle xenoliths from large amount of the kimberlite pipes from N America Yakutia, Baltica , South and Central Africa. Proterozoic pipes from Africa like Premier Roberts Victor show in general higher heating degree which is visible especially by the by the high temperature PT subadiabatic arrays for SCLM beneath Premier from the deep level at 70 kbar (Fig. 1). The diamond inclusions and diamond eclogites from Roberts Victor support this thesis. (Fig 2). But common pipes beneath Kaapvaal craton refer to 40mw/m2 geotherm in the middle part and heating at 60 kbar and different PT paths for the mantle eclogites. Diamond inclusions reveal colder and deeper conditions and several PT paths.
